    Aruba to form committee to decide future of idled refinery -prime minister

    May 27, 2019
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n WhatsApp
    Citgo refinery

    News Wires — The government of Aruba said on Monday it will form an advisory committee to decide the future of a 209,000-barrel-per-day refinery that remains idled amid sanctions to operator Citgo Petroleum’s parent company, Petroleos de Venezuela (PDVSA).

    Prime Minister Evelyn Wever-Croes said Aruba sees three possible scenarios for the refinery: to continue working with Citgo on an overhaul, to negotiate a Citgo contract termination and continue with the plant, or to use the facility for a different activity.
